Royal Caribbean Cruises Ltd. 15th Annual G.I.V.E. Day To Assist Tanganyika Wildlife Park
WICHITA, Kan., April 27, 2012 /PRNewswire/ -- More than 140 volunteers from Royal Caribbean Cruises Ltd. will spend this Saturday, April 28, from 8:30 a.m. to 12:30 p.m. cleaning, planting and handling other projects at Tanganyika Wildlife Park as part of Royal Caribbean Cruises Ltd.'s 15th annual "G.I.V.E. Day."
G.I.V.E., which stands for "Get Involved, Volunteer Everywhere," is a community service event that brings together Royal Caribbean International, Celebrity Cruises and Azamara Club Cruises employees, their families and friends to assist non-profit organizations and improve the quality of life in their local communities. The volunteers will help prepare the wildlife park for its summer season, assisting the park's small staff with such laborious tasks as erecting fences, laying sod, cleaning animal enclosures and tackling other landscaping projects in the wildlife park.
Tanganyika is a non-profit specialty zoo that takes pride in educating the public about endangered species, while increasing the population of certain species through quality breeding programs. At the park, visitors may find themselves face-to-face with a kangaroo, have a giraffe eating out of their hand, or look up to a ring-tailed lemur on their shoulder – experiences designed to make every visit memorable.
"Our company is committed to supporting and helping the communities in which we live and work," said Mike Semler, Director of Trade Support & Services, Royal Caribbean. "We hope the personal satisfaction and fun of assisting our neighbors on G.I.V.E. Day will help inspire our participants to pursue volunteer and public service opportunities throughout the year."
Now in its 15th year, G.I.V.E. Day is an example of how the more than 40,000 Royal Caribbean employees give back to their communities around the world, by donating thousands of volunteer hours to assist their communities with neighborhood development, civic drives, environmental improvement and disaster recovery. Similar G.I.V.E. Day events are also being planned for and will take place in Wichita, Kansas; Anchorage, Alaska; Seattle, Washington; Springfield, Oregon, United Kingdom, Germany and other international offices.
Royal Caribbean Cruises Ltd. (NYSE, OSE: RCL) is a global cruise vacation company that also operates Royal Caribbean International, Celebrity Cruises, Azamara Club Cruises, Pullmantur, CDF Croisieres de France, as well as TUI Cruises through a 50 percent joint venture with TUI AG. The company owns a combined total of 40 ships and has one under construction and two under agreement. It also offers unique land-tour vacations in Alaska, Asia, Australia/New Zealand, Canada, Dubai, Europe and South America.
